CalcTime has four window tabs labeled "Regular Time AM/PM," "Military Time 24/Hours," "Time Log" and "Time Tape.

The Regular Time AM/PM and Military Time 24/Hours tabs add or subtract one time of day to or from another.

The Time Log is a clock-in and out log with printable reports.

Time Tape allows you to add or subtract any number of time entries. You can print your Time Tape for review and audit. All report titles are customizeable.
